Position Overview
Exciting opportunity to lead Cloud transformation!
As Cloud Transformation Lead, you will oversee the establishment of the Court’s new Cloud platform team. You will be responsible for the delivery of strategic Cloud initiatives that support the Court’s major digital transformation project, the Digital Court Program (DCP), as well as wider Cloud adoption across the Federal Court, Federal Circuit and Family Court and National Native Title Tribunal.
Reporting to the Program Manager – Digital Court Program, you will be based in Melbourne, Sydney, Canberra, Brisbane, Perth or Adelaide and have access to the Court’s flexible work arrangements.
You’ll link strategic planning to practical action and ensure the ongoing review and enhancement of Cloud maturity at the courts. Your responsibilities include:
- Lead the establishment and operation of the Cloud Platform Team, ensuring that strategy, capacity and capabilities are identified, developed, and maintained.
- Lead the design, development and technical implementation of a range of Microsoft Azure and related Cloud systems, including establishment and alignment with new and existing governance and policy arrangements.
- Convey complex technical concepts to broad audiences, including senior stakeholders, to ensure that cost, risk management and sustainability measures are communicated and endorsed.
- Ability to iterate and work flexibly to ensure that strategy and focus adapt to suit changing circumstances.
